[0024] It should be noted that, in the case of no conflict, the embodiments in the present application and the features in the embodiments can be combined with each other.

[0025] Such as figure 1 As shown, a method for identifying an LED lighting fixture includes the steps of: S1, setting or generating signature information of the LED lighting fixture; S2, modulating the signature information, and sending it with an optical signal through the LED lighting fixture; S3, receiving An optical signal with signature information, and converting the optical signal into an electrical signal; S4, demodulating the electrical signal, extracting the signature information, and identifying or judging the signature information.

[0026] Preferably, the step S2 specifically includes: modulating the signature information with the PPM code, and sending it as an optical signal through the LED lighting fixture.

Abstract

The invention discloses an LED lighting lamp identification method, a lamp, a verification device and a system. The method comprises the steps that S1, signature information of the LED lighting lamp is generated; S2, the signature information is modulated and transmitted in the mode of an optical signal via the LED lighting lamp; S3, the optical signal with the signature information is received, and the optical signal is converted into an electric signal; and S4, the electric signal is demodulated, the signature information is extracted and the signature information is identified or judged. The lamp comprises a control unit, an LED driver and an LED lamp. The verification device comprises a photoelectric conversion unit, a signal demodulation unit and a digital processing unit. The system comprises the LED lighting lamp and the verification device of the LED lighting lamp. Judgment of authenticity of the lamp is realized, and characteristics that optical signal transmission is not affected by electromagnetic interference and has no penetrability are utilized so that reliability and security of signature information transmission are realized. Besides, additional cost is not increased or only a small part of cost is increased. The LED lighting lamp identification method can be widely applied to various LED lighting lamp identification systems.

Description

technical field [0001] The invention belongs to the field of LED communication, and in particular relates to a method for realizing lamp identification through the light emitted by the LED lighting lamp itself. The invention also relates to an LED lighting lamp, a verification device for the LED lighting lamp and a system for identifying the lamp. Background technique [0002] PPM: pulse position modulation, using the modulation signal to control the relative position (ie phase) of each pulse in the pulse sequence, so that the relative position of each pulse changes with the modulation signal. [0003] The current authenticity identification technology and anti-repudiation technology mainly include laser anti-repudiation code, bar code (or two-dimensional code) and RFID anti-repudiation and so on.
